Chinese Porcelain Bowl on Stand, Rosalind Russell
Chinese. Large blue, white and iron red porcelain palace bowl on wooden stand with glass top for use as a table, decorated with dragons and florals to the exterior and carp to the interior. Marked to underside. Approx. as a whole, h. 20.5", dia. 20"; bowl, h. 10", dia. 20". Provenance: From the estate of the comedic actress Rosalind Russell, sold by C.B. Charles Galleries, October 19, 20 and 21 1984, lot 457.
Condition Report: Non-distracting firing/glaze imperfections; no apparent repairs or chips; glass top does not sit flush with rim.
